Received my Mosin/Nagant 91/30 this morning,checked head space and general condition at the FFL,beautiful furniture,all numbers except the magazine floor plate were original match.Floorplate was an arsenal scratchout and renumbered.Hardly any cosmoline anywhere,looked hard and long to find a little in the groove under the cleaning rod.Took it home,ran a brush and a few patches thru the barrel,shiny bore with crisp rifling,excellent crown,bluing has only minor rub near end of barrel,under the top handguard looks like brand new.Disassembled and cleaned heavy oil from inside bolt,lubricated,adjusted pin protrusion(it was correct before disassembly)and went to the range.Shoots a little high as expected at 50 and 100 yards,about right at 200,without bayonet attached.Windy day,hitting left a little,but hit all the targets and the bull with a little kentucky windage with open sights and 62 year old tired eyes.Love it.couldn't ask for more.
